Judgment of the Court (Tenth Chamber) of 4 June 2020 — Terna SpA v European Commission
(Case C-812/18 P) (1)
(Appeal - Energy - Projects of common interest to the EU - EU financial assistance granted to two projects in the field of trans-European energy networks - Directive 2004/17/EC - Article 37 - Subcontracting - Article 40(3)(c) - Direct award - Technical specificity - Framework agreement - Reduction of the assistance originally granted following a financial audit - Reimbursement of amounts originally paid)
(2020/C 262/05)
Language of the case: Italian
Parties
Appellant: Terna SpA (represented by: F. Covone, A. Police, L. Di Via, D. Carria and F. Degni, avvocati)
Other party to the proceedings: European Commission (represented by: O. Beynet, M. Ilkova, G. Gattinara and P. Ondrůšek, acting as Agents)
Operative part of the judgment
The Court:
1. |
Dismisses the appeal; |
2. |
Orders Terna SpA to pay the costs. |
